This is a printed report by Sir Edgar Bonham Carter, Judicial Secretary, Baghdad, concerning the legal jurisdiction over foreigners in Mesopotamia. The report includes details of various schemes, including: 'Scheme to vest in the ordinary Courts jurisdiction to hear all cases in which Foreigners are interested', 'Scheme to create special Mixed Tribunals on the Egyptian model and confer on them jurisdiction in all cases in which foreigners are interested', 'Scheme to vest in British Judges or in Special Courts composed of British and Mesopotamian Judges to hear all cases in which foreigners are interested'. In addition, the report includes three appendices: 'Appendix I: Translation of Imperial Iradeh, dated 26th Aab 1330 (8th September 1914), abolishing the Capitulations'; 'Appendix II: Turkey and Persia. Treaty dated 31st May 1847. Article VII. Appointment of Consuls, Privileges, Most Favoured Nation Treatment'; and 'Appendix II: Juridiction of a Peace Court'.
